Spécifications

Attribut Valeur
Package / Case Bulk,Tube
Part Status Active
Number of Bits 8
Sampling Rate(Per Second) 32M
Number of Inputs 1
Input Type Differential, Single Ended
Data Interface Parallel
Configuration S/H-ADC
Ratio - S / H: ADC 1:1
Number of A/D Converters 1
Architecture Pipelined
Reference Type External
Voltage - Supply, Analog 2.7V ~ 5.5V
Voltage - Supply, Digital 2.7V ~ 5.5V
Operating Temperature -40°C ~ 85°C
Supplier Device Package 28-SSOP

Description

The AD9280ARSZ is an 8-bit, monolithic analog-to-digital converter (ADC) from Analog Devices, designed for high-speed, low-power applications. Key features:
- Resolution & Speed: 8-bit resolution with a sampling rate up to 32 MSPS (Mega Samples Per Second).
- Input Range: Single-ended analog input with a 1 Vpp full-scale range.
- Power Efficiency: Operates on a single 3V supply, consuming just 95 mW at 32 MSPS.
- Interface: Parallel CMOS/TTL-compatible output.
- Applications: Ideal for video digitization, medical imaging, and communications systems.
The AD9280ARSZ comes in a 28-lead SSOP package, offering a compact solution for space-constrained designs. Its low power and high-speed performance make it suitable for portable and embedded systems.
